The Hampton Inn & Suites hotel in Savannah Historic District is near Savannah's famous River Street, City Market, SCAD, and more. Rest easy in the comfort of your room and wake up to a hot free breakfast each day before exploring historic Savannah. On a hot day, choose to take a swim in our outdoor pool.

What a gem! It is just across the street and a flight of stairs from the river walk. The hotel was recently renovated, and everything is pristine. The fitness room is well equipped. The staff was very attentive in the breakfast room and at the front desk. The only feature that is less than ideal is the driveway and the parking. The valet service is very expensive, but the front desk was upfront in telling us a parking garage a block away is at least half the price. Unloading/loading is cramped and tricky. Make sure your most skilled driver deals with that challenge! We really enjoyed our stay and will consider for our next visit.

Frequently Asked Questions about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District
Which popular attractions are close to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Nearby attractions include Savannah Historic District (0.3 km), Pounce Cat Cafe (0.3 km), and First African Baptist Church (0.4 km).
What are some of the property amenities at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Some of the more popular amenities offered include free wifi, free breakfast, and a pool.
What food & drink options are available at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Guests can enjoy free breakfast during their stay.
Is parking available at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Yes, paid private parking on-site, paid private parking nearby, and valet parking are available to guests.
What are some restaurants close to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Conveniently located restaurants include Jazz'd Tapas Bar, Noble Fare, and FraLi Gourmet.
Are there opportunities to exercise at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Yes, guests have access to a pool and a fitness centre during their stay.
Is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District located near the city centre?
Yes, it is 0.7 km away from the centre of Savannah.
Are any cleaning services offered at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Yes, dry cleaning and laundry service are offered to guests.
Does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District offer any business services?
Yes, it conveniently offers a business centre, meeting rooms, and a banquet room.
Are there any historical sites close to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District?
Many travellers enjoy visiting Savannah Historic District (0.3 km), Flannery O'Connor Childhood Home Museum (0.9 km), and Olde Pink House (0.8 km).
Is Hampton Inn & Suites Savannah Historic District accessible?
Yes, it offers wheelchair access and facilities for disabled guests. For specific enquiries, we recommend calling ahead to confirm.
